Breastfeeding is often described as natural, which can make it all the more confusing when it turns out to be hard. Painful latching, worries about milk supply, a baby who won't settle, these are common, and they are exactly what a lactation consultant in Hyderabad is there to help with.

At BirthRight by Rainbow Hospitals, the lactation expert works with mothers from the very first feed. They help with positioning and latching, troubleshoot problems such as engorgement or low supply, and give practical, judgement-free advice tailored to each mother and baby.

Why Consult a Lactation Expert & Common Challenges Lactation Consultants Help Address

Lactation consultants help with the everyday difficulties that can make feeding stressful, including:

  • Painful or shallow latching

  • Sore, cracked, or bleeding nipples

  • Engorgement and blocked ducts

  • Low milk supply or oversupply

  • Mastitis and other breast infections

  • Feeding premature or low-birth-weight babies

  • Combination feeding and returning to work

Many of these problems are very fixable once the cause is clear, and small adjustments to positioning, timing, or technique often make a noticeable difference within just a few days.

Benefits of Breastfeeding for Mothers and Babies

Breastfeeding offers real benefits for both mother and baby. For babies, breast milk provides ideal nutrition and antibodies that help protect against infections. For mothers, it supports recovery after birth and strengthens the bond with the baby. That said, every family's situation is different, and the point of good lactation support is never pressure; it is to help you feed your baby in the way that works best for both of you, with fewer problems along the way. Even short-term breastfeeding has value, and having expert help on hand makes it more likely you can continue breastfeeding for as long as you want.

What causes low breast milk supply?

Causes include infrequent feeding, latch problems, stress, certain medications, or health conditions. A lactation consultant can identify the cause and suggest practical fixes.

Can lactation consultants help mothers of premature babies?

Yes. They offer specialised support for premature babies, including milk expression, building supply, and gradually transitioning to direct breastfeeding.

How often should newborns be breastfed?

Newborns usually feed every two to three hours, around eight to twelve times a day. Feeding on demand is generally encouraged in the early weeks.

What foods help improve breast milk production?

Staying well hydrated and eating a balanced diet helps most. Some mothers find foods like oats useful, but frequent feeding matters most for supply.

What qualifications should I look for in a lactation consultant?

Look for someone board-certified, with proper training in lactation support and experience handling a range of breastfeeding issues.

Can lactation consulting help with medical conditions affecting breastfeeding?

Yes. Consultants support mothers with issues like mastitis, thrush, or nipple infections, working with doctors where medical treatment is needed.

What should I expect during a lactation consultation?

The consultant asks about your experience and concerns, often watches a feed, and offers guidance on positioning, latching, pumping, and storage.
